High Country Family by Betty Dick. 'Lilybank station lies at the head of Lake Tekapo, one of the loveliest features of New Zealand's South Island "McKenzie Country". Here Betty Dick lived and raised a family (four sons and one daughter) and shared station life and work with her husband Allan, the owner of Lilybank. Into this life her children entered with tremendous enthusiasm, revelling in working with horses, dogs and stock, and reluctantly enduring correspondence school lessons conducted by a firm but sympathetic tutor - their mother. From her experience as a high country wife and mother, as a partner of a hard working country M.P., and as a welcome visitor to Government House, Betty Dick has written a fascinating book.
